Brief Summary: The aims of this study are

1 to explore a novel 2D-Cardiovascular magnetic resonance CMR indirect method for tricuspid regurgitation TR quantification ATRIAL method relying on right atrium variables and assess its agreement with the traditional indirect method involving right ventricle variables and the direct method based on through-plane phase contrast PC sequences on the tricuspid valve
2 to assess the agreement of TR volume RVol and regurgitant fraction quantification from 2D-CMR methods with transthoracic echocardiography and 4DF-CMR methods
3 to assess the diagnostic performance of 2D-CMR in classifying TR in terms of RVol and regurgitant fraction with respect to echocardiographic transthoracic echocardiography grades
